General Information Age Group Adults Status Active Protocol Number EVP-DEV-LTX-301 Background Information The purpose of this study is to test the safety and effectiveness of the EVLP system in allowing the evaluation of potential donor lungs otherwise not used for transplant into patients. Offered At Inova Fairfax Hospital 3300 Gallows Rd. Falls Church, VA 22042 Principal Investigator Anne W. Brown, MD Eligibility Information Male or female Aged 18 years or older Informed consent is given for participation in the Study by the patient or patient's designated representative Patient undergoes lung transplantation Ineligibility Information Patients listed for same-side lung re-transplantation Patients listed for multiple organ transplantation including lung and any other organ Patients listed for live donor lobar lung transplant Patients positive for human immunodeficiency virus (HIV) or Burkholderia cenocepacia infection Patient receives a standard of care (non-EVLP) lung transplant but does not match to an EVLP subject based on the criteria for control matching Participating in another interventional trial More information: https://clinicaltrials.gov/ct2/show/NCT03641677 Contact Information Contact Name Colleen Mann, RN Contact Phone 703-776-6485 Contact Email Send Email
